Frequently asked questions

Can I send the invitation straight to a printer?

Yes. It exports a 5×7 inch, 300dpi PNG that meets most home-print and print-shop requirements; a printer can handle bleed/CMYK on request. There's also an on-demand wedding-print option below to print and mail.

Can I use it as a digital invitation?

Absolutely. The exported image can be sent by email or messaging as-is — an instant digital invite with no printing needed.

Does it support non-Latin names?

Yes. Both Latin and CJK names render with your device's system fonts and export at that moment, so glyphs are crisp without downloading anything.

About the output

When downloading an image, check its dimensions and text before using it. Pixel dimensions alone do not set its physical size on paper; check the paper size and scaling in your print application.
